Ejemplo n.º 1
0
        public void Remove_Event()
        {
            var eventIdToRemove = 2;
            var eventRepository = new EventRepository();
            var userRepository = new FakeUserRepo();
            var mailService = new MailService(userRepository);

            var eventController = new EventController(eventRepository, userRepository, mailService);
            eventController.RemoveEvent(eventIdToRemove);
        }
Ejemplo n.º 2
0
 public void Create_Event()
 {
     var repo = new EventRepository();
     var newEvent = new Event
     {
         Id = 2,
         Subject = "test",
         Body = "body",
         Category = new Category
         {
             Id = 1
         },
         CreatedBy = new User
         {
             Id = 1,
             Email = "*****@*****.**"
         },
         Date = DateTime.Today,
         From = DateTime.Now.AddHours(-1).TimeOfDay,
         To = DateTime.Now.AddHours(1).TimeOfDay,
     };
     repo.Create(newEvent);
 }
Ejemplo n.º 3
0
 public void EventRepo_Range()
 {
     var eventRepository = new EventRepository();
     var events = eventRepository.Get(DateTime.Now, PeriodType.Month);
     Assert.AreEqual(6, events.Count());
 }
Ejemplo n.º 4
0
 public void Remove_Event_Repo_Only()
 {
     var eventIdToRemove = 1;
     var eventRepository = new EventRepository();
     eventRepository.Remove(eventIdToRemove);
 }